PanStreet and Zebra in the Valley of the Kings

The development process of „Ramesses III. – Publication and Conservation Project“ began in 2011. In 2017, the concession for this project was granted by the Egyptian Ministry of Tourism and Antiquities. The project focuses on the preservation, documentation and publication of the tomb of King Ramesses III.The project is institutionally supervised by the Humboldt-Universität in Berlin, in cooperation with the Egyptian universities of Luxor and Qena.

 

The company Zebra, a manufacturer of mobile handheld computers, has just provided the terminals for excavation for this project.  For implementing this work, Zebra needed a project partner handling the service. In this context, the company Zebra had the idea to take its business partner PanStreet International as a project partner on board. PanStreet International based in Meerbusch in the German Federal State of North-Rhine Westphalia has just won the „ZEBRA Innovation Award 2022“. In the framework of this project, PanStreet International purchases and provides the hardware, this means the devices, and it is entrusted with the service and warranty handling.  Zebra is sponsoring the devices in this project and PanStreet International is sponsoring the service.

Multiple application options of PanStreet Traffic Monitoring System

 

PanStreet International belonging to the Schweers group has an excellent reputation because of its company software Politess® Mobile. It is primarily used for the detection of parking violations and for the recording of general offences.

 

Due to the possibility of the integration of GPS data determination PanStreet International was in the position to develop a new app for the Düsseldorf carnival procession on 20 February 2023. By means of this app an active mobile device could regularly send GPS data about the course of the procession, as well as images created directly on the mobile device, automatically to the central organization office of the carnival procession in Düsseldorf. This project was very successful. There are, thus, manifold options for the application of the software Politess® Mobile for Android & iOS from the company PanStreet International including event and traffic flow monitoring.  In this way, the software makes a considerable contribution to counteracting or averting a traffic collapse, especially in conurbations.

Minister of Finance and Environment visits project of Schweers and EasyMile in Meerbusch-Büderich

The Areal Böhler owned by the company voestalpine in Meerbusch-Büderich is an industrial park for fairs, exhibitions and other events with a clear focus on the promotion of innovative business ideas. The location offers excellent conditions for start-ups to present themselves and, thus, achieving a value added for their companies. The Areal Böhler is open to new technologies as well as ecological and sustainable business approaches.


For a company giving priority to innovation, sustainability and technological progress like the company Schweers/PanStreet in Meerbusch-Osterath the importance of the long-standing co-operation with the Areal Böhler is not to be underestimated. Being on the pulse of time, Schweers/PanStreet has just started a pilot project in the field of innovative mobility technologies with the company EasyMile at the Areal Böhler. An autonomous electric bus of the company EasyMile is now driving at the site of the industrial park and offers a shuttle service between the exhibition halls for visitors.


On 19 April 2022 the Minster for Finance and Environment of the German federal state of North-Rhine-Westphalia Lutz Lienenkämper visited the Areal Böhler. The pilot project attracted his great interest, because it fits very well with the ideas of the federal government of North-Rhine-Westphalia giving technological progress, the promotion of the power of innovation of the enterprises in North-Rhine-Westphalia and sustainability highest priority on its political agenda. Lutz Lienenkämper did not miss the opportunity to drive with the electric autonomous bus. It was a very pleasant driving experience for him. "Based on the biography of Minister Lienenkämper, who has already been Minister of Transport in North Rhine-Westphalia, I am particularly pleased that he is very familiar with the field of innovative mobility technologies. We succeeded very well in demonstrating to Lutz Lienenkämper the synergy effects of the co-operation between Schweers and the Areal Böhler," emphasized Michael Schweers, Owner and Managing Director of Schweers/PanStreet.


As current Minister of the Environment and former Minister of Transport, Lutz Lienenkämper also noticed the green background of the electrically powered buses very positively. The minister also stressed how important it is to think about the future already today. The Level 4 operation planned for the end of the year is the first project of this kind in Germany.
